> 1. SarI' - my I use that as a greeting?
You may *use* anything you like; {SarI'} means "I hail all of you." However,
Klingons don't tend to use greetings. They just get down to business. Since
I'm reading a message from you, of *course* you are hailing us!
> (are there really no greetings in Klingon? How do they greet their best
> friends?)
They might see each other and call out their names, grab their arms, embrace,
or just head-butt each other. A greeting needn't use words.

> 4. how do you translate Dajonlu'pa' ?
> you-it-before-one-capture ?
When you use the Type 5 verb suffix {-lu'}, the meaning of the verb prefix
changes. See TKD section 4.2.5.
"Before someone captures you."
"Before you are captured."
